Hi,
Can I upgrade HP G62-B40SJ RAM memory to 8GB (2X4GB)?
Is this memory KVR16LS11 / 4 compatible with the HP G62-b40SJ?

It can run 8 gigs. Appears it is a first generation Intel Core system but I cannot locate the specs for it. It uses DDR3-1066 memory and the memory you ask about is a newer kind; DDR3L-1600. On that model you need to be sure to get low density memory 1.5 volt like this:

02-01-2020 06:37 AM
No that is 1600 speed memory. You need 1066 speed memory and it has to be 1.5 volts and it has to be low density on that system. That means the memory module will have 8 black blocks on the side. This model series is very finicky about its memory and will not work if you try to install newer faster memory.
